The term SWEDD (scans without evidence for dopaminergic deficit) refers to the absence, rather than the presence, of an imaging abnormality in patients clinically presumed to have Parkinson's disease (PD). However, such a term has since been widely used in the medical literature, even as a diagnostic label. While many authors have suggested that different disorders of PD lookalikes may account for a proportion of SWEDD cases, others have claimed that some of them may have a benign subtype of PD. Thus, there has been ensuing controversy and confusion and the use of this term continues without clarity of what it represents. We have systematically reviewed all the studies involving patients with SWEDD with the aim of shedding light on what these patients actually have. It becomes clear from this systematic review that while most 'SWEDD' cases are due to a clinical misdiagnosis of PD, there exists a small proportion of patients with SWEDD who may have PD on the basis of a positive levodopa response, clinical progression, imaging and/or genetic evidence. The latter challenge the seemingly incontrovertible relationship between dopaminergic tracer binding and the diagnosis of nigrostriatal parkinsonism, particularly PD. Patients with SWEDD are unlikely to reflect a single clinical entity and we suggest that the term SWEDD should be abandoned.

PURPOSE: Atypical parkinsonism (AP) has a considerable impact on the lives not only of patients but also of their carers. The aim of this study was to develop an instrument for assessing the quality of life (QoL) of carers of patients with AP. METHODS: A 40-item pool was generated from in-depth interviews with carers of patients with AP, a thorough review of the existing literature and consultation with movement disorder experts. Item refinement and reduction was performed using the results of pilot testing and a survey in 282 carers of multiple system atrophy (MSA) patients and 226 carers of progressive supranuclear palsy (PSP) patients. A validation study, with responses of 243 carers of MSA and 187 carers of PSP patients, was undertaken to evaluate the psychometric properties of the final 26-item scale. RESULTS: The validation study results suggest that the scale is unidimensional and has high internal consistency (Cronbach's α = 0.96). The correlations of scale scores with patients' health status and QoL measures, such as PDQ-39 summary score and EQ-5D index (Spearman's ρ = 0.56 and -0.31, respectively, P < 0.001), as well as carers' measures, such as Caregiver Burden Inventory (CBI) total and EQ-5D index (Spearman's ρ = 0.85 and -0.39, respectively, P < 0.001), document the convergent and concurrent validity of the scale. ANOVA results support the discriminant validity of the scale, as evidenced by its capacity to differentiate between carers with varying levels of self-reported health. CONCLUSIONS: The 26-item Parkinsonism Carers QoL (PQoL Carer) is a concise instrument with adequate psychometric qualities that can be used for clinical and research purposes.

Recently, mutations in the TUBB4A gene have been found to underlie hypomyelination with atrophy of the basal ganglia and cerebellum (H-ABC) syndrome, a rare neurodegenerative disorder of infancy and childhood. TUBB4A mutations also have been described as causative of DYT4 ("hereditary whispering dysphonia"). However, in DYT4, brain imaging has been reported to be normal and, therefore, H-ABC syndrome and DYT4 have been construed to be different disorders, despite some phenotypic overlap. Hence, the question of whether these disorders reflect variable expressivity or pleiotropy of TUBB4A mutations has been raised. We report four unrelated patients with imaging findings either partially or totally consistent with H-ABC syndrome, who were found to have TUBB4A mutations. All four subjects had a relatively homogenous phenotype characterized by severe generalized dystonia with superimposed pyramidal and cerebellar signs, and also bulbar involvement leading to complete aphonia and swallowing difficulties, even though one of the cases had an intermediate phenotype between H-ABC syndrome and DYT4. Genetic analysis of the TUBB4A gene showed one previously described and two novel mutations (c.941C>T; p.Ala314Val and c.900G>T; p.Met300Ile) in the exon 4 of the gene. While expanding the genetic spectrum of H-ABC syndrome, we confirm its radiological heterogeneity and demonstrate that phenotypic overlap with DYT4. Moreover, reappraisal of previously reported cases would also argue against pleiotropy of TUBB4A mutations. We therefore suggest that H-ABC and DYT4 belong to a continuous phenotypic spectrum associated with TUBB4A mutations.

Recently, a number of genetic parkinsonian conditions have been recognized that share some features with the clinical syndromes of progressive supranuclear palsy (PSP), corticobasal degeneration (CBD), and multiple system atrophy (MSA), the classic phenotypic templates of atypical parkinsonism. For example, patients with progranulin, dynactin, or ATP13A gene mutations may have vertical supranuclear gaze palsy. This has made differential diagnosis difficult for practitioners. In this review, our goal is to make clinicians aware of these genetic disorders and provide clinical clues and syndromic associations, as well as investigative features, that may help in diagnosing these disorders. The correct identification of these patients has important clinical, therapeutic, and research implications. © 2013 Movement Disorder Society.

Background: Multiple system atrophy (MSA) is a devastating disease characterized by a variable combination of motor and autonomic symptoms. Previous studies identified numerous clinical factors to be associated with shorter survival. Objective: To enable personalized patient counseling, we aimed at developing a risk model of survival based on baseline clinical symptoms. Methods: MSA patients referred to the Movement Disorders Unit in Innsbruck, Austria, between 1999 and 2016 were retrospectively analyzed. Kaplan-Meier curves and multivariate Cox regression analysis with least absolute shrinkage and selection operator penalty for variable selection were performed to identify prognostic factors. A nomogram was developed to estimate the 7 years overall survival probability. The performance of the predictive model was validated and calibrated internally using bootstrap resampling and externally using data from the prospective European MSA Study Group Natural History Study. Results: A total of 210 MSA patients were included in this analysis, of which 124 patients died. The median survival was 7 years. The following clinical variables were found to significantly affect overall survival and were included in the nomogram: age at symptom onset, falls within 3 years of onset, early autonomic failure including orthostatic hypotension and urogenital failure, and lacking levodopa response. The time-dependent area under curve for internal and external validation was >0.7 within the first 7 years of the disease course. The model was well calibrated showing good overlap between predicted and actual survival probability at 7 years. Conclusion: The nomogram is a simple tool to predict survival on an individual basis and may help to improve counseling and treatment of MSA patients.

BACKGROUND: The Unified Multiple System Atrophy Rating Scale (UMSARS) was developed to provide a surrogate measure of disease progression in multiple system atrophy. In the present study, the intrarater agreement of the motor examination part of the UMSARS was determined. METHODS: All patients were first examined face to face, while being video-recorded, by two senior and two junior investigators. The patients' videotaped examinations were reevaluated after 3 months. Intrarater reliability for each item was analyzed by kappa statistics. RESULTS: Overall weighted kappa (κ) values were at least substantial or excellent for all UMSARS motor examination items, except for ocular motor dysfunction, which showed only moderate intrarater agreement. Intrarater reliability was comparable between senior and junior raters, with all κ differences being ≤ 0.22. CONCLUSIONS: The motor examination part of the UMSARS was found to have satisfactory intrarater reliability in the present cohort.

The commonest cause of pathological tremor is essential tremor (ET). However, it has proved difficult to identify genetic mutations causing ET, particularly because other causes of tremor continue to be misdiagnosed as ET. Whether subjects with dystonia or Parkinson's disease (PD) carry an increased genetic risk of developing ET, or vice versa, is controversial. In addition, the notion of a separate disorder of benign tremulous parkinsonism (BTP) has been debated. This article gives a selective viewpoint on some areas of uncertainty and controversy in tremor.

Deep brain stimulation to the internal globus pallidus is an effective treatment for primary dystonia. The optimal clinical effect often occurs only weeks to months after starting stimulation. To better understand the underlying electrophysiological changes in this period, we assessed longitudinally 2 pathophysiological markers of dystonia in patients prior to and in the early treatment period (1, 3, 6 months) after deep brain stimulation surgery. Transcranial magnetic stimulation was used to track changes in short-latency intracortical inhibition, a measure of excitability of GABA(A) -ergic corticocortical connections and long-term potentiation-like synaptic plasticity (as a response to paired associative stimulation). Deep brain stimulation remained on for the duration of the study. Prior to surgery, inhibition was reduced and plasticity increased in patients compared with healthy controls. Following surgery and commencement of deep brain stimulation, short-latency intracortical inhibition increased toward normal levels over the following months with the same monotonic time course as the patients' clinical benefit. In contrast, synaptic plasticity changed rapidly, following a nonmonotonic time course: it was absent early (1 month) after surgery, and then over the following months increased toward levels observed in healthy individuals. We postulate that before surgery preexisting high levels of plasticity form strong memories of dystonic movement patterns. When deep brain stimulation is turned on, it disrupts abnormal basal ganglia signals, resulting in the absent response to paired associative stimulation at 1 month. Clinical benefit is delayed because engrams of abnormal movement persist and take time to normalize. Our observations suggest that plasticity may be a driver of long-term therapeutic effects of deep brain stimulation in dystonia.

Graft-induced dyskinesias are a serious complication after neural transplantation in Parkinson's disease. One patient with Parkinson's disease, treated with fetal grafts 14 years ago and deep brain stimulation 6 years ago, showed marked improvement of motor symptoms but continued to suffer from OFF-medication graft-induced dyskinesias. The patient received a series of clinical and imaging assessments. Positron emission tomography and single-photon emission computed tomography 14 years posttransplantation revealed an elevated serotonin/dopamine transporter ratio in the grafted striatum compatible with serotonergic hyperinnervation. Inhibition of serotonin neuron activity by systemic administration of a 5-HT(1A) agonist suppressed graft-induced dyskinesias. Our data provide further evidence that serotonergic neurons mediate graft-induced dyskinesias in Parkinson's disease. Achieving a normal striatal serotonin/dopamine transporter ratio following transplantation of fetal tissue or stem cells should be necessary to avoid the development of graft-induced dyskinesias.

The Hippo pathway regulates a complex signalling network which mediates several biological functions including cell proliferation, organ size and apoptosis. Several scaffold proteins regulate the crosstalk of the members of the pathway with other signalling pathways and play an important role in the diverse output controlled by this pathway. In this study we have identified the scaffold protein IQGAP1 as a novel interactor of the core kinases of the Hippo pathway, MST2 and LATS1. Our results indicate that IQGAP1 scaffolds MST2 and LATS1 supresses their kinase activity and YAP1-dependent transcription. Additionally, we show that IQGAP1 is a negative regulator of the non-canonical pro-apoptotic pathway and may enable the crosstalk between this pathway and the ERK and AKT signalling modules. Our data also show that bile acids regulate the IQGAP1-MST2-LATS1 signalling module in hepatocellular carcinoma cells, which could be necessary for the inhibition of MST2-dependent apoptosis and hepatocyte transformation.

There is an increasing awareness of impulsive-compulsive phenomena in patients treated for Parkinson's disease (PD). We describe another, potentially related phenomenon putatively associated with the use of dopamine agonists in 3 patients with PD, characterized by excessive and inappropriate philanthropy.

Kufor Rakeb disease (KRD, PARK9) is an autosomal recessive extrapyramidal-pyramidal syndrome with generalized brain atrophy due to ATP13A2 gene mutations. We report clinical details and investigational results focusing on radiological findings of a genetically-proven KRD case. Clinically, there was early onset levodopa-responsive dystonia-parkinsonism with pyramidal signs and eye movement abnormalities. Brain MRI revealed generalized atrophy and putaminal and caudate iron accumulation bilaterally. Our findings add KRD to the group of syndromes of neurodegeneration with brain iron accumulation (NBIA). KRD should be considered in patients with dystonia-parkinsonism with iron on brain imaging and we suggest classifying as NBIA type 3.

The aim of the study was to explore the prevalence and differences of nonmotor symptoms (NMSs) in patients with young-onset Parkinson's disease (YOPD) with and without mutations in the Parkin gene and late-onset Parkinson's disease (LOPD). Twenty-seven patients with YOPD and 27 with LOPD, as well as 16 patients with homozygous or compound heterozygote Parkin mutations filled in the nonmotor symptoms questionnaire, a 30-item self-completed questionnaire that addresses various NMSs. Overall, NMSs were more prevalent in YOPD (12.07 +/- 3.9; P = 0.009) and LOPD (13.26 +/- 5.8; P = 0.001) compared with Parkin mutation carriers (7.38 +/- 4.2). Dribbling of saliva, vivid dreams, loss of smell, and urinary urgency were more prevalent in YOPD compared with Parkin mutation carriers. Only anxiety was more prevalent in the latter. Apart from anxiety, NMSs appear to be less prevalent in Parkin gene-related parkinsonism. Although these results need further study, the presented data might be helpful in the clinical recognition of specific phenotypes and genotypes in YOPD. The data are in keeping with a different pathological disease process in Parkin gene-related parkinsonism.

The objective of this study was to compare subjective health status and its correlates in progressive supranuclear palsy (PSP) and multiple system atrophy (MSA). One hundred eighty-eight patients with PSP and 286 patients with MSA completed EQ-5D and Hospital Depression and Anxiety Scale. The impact on mobility, usual activities, and self-care was similarly high in both groups after similar duration. Fifty-six percent of PSP and 43% of MSA had probable depression, and 37% of both groups had probable anxiety. Patients with PSP had significantly higher depression scores, but groups did not differ in anxiety scores. Patients with MSA had significantly greater pain/discomfort than patients with PSP. The most important association with subjective health status was with depressive symptoms, which accounted for 38% and 29% of EQ-5D variance in patients with PSP and MSA, followed by disease severity and anxiety scores. We conclude that depressive symptoms were common in both disorders, but more severe in PSP. Anxiety symptoms affected 37% of patients in both groups and contributed to impaired subjective health status. Pain was more problematic in MSA than PSP.

We report the 5 to 6 year follow-up of a multicenter study of bilateral subthalamic nucleus (STN) and globus pallidus internus (GPi) deep brain stimulation (DBS) in advanced Parkinson's disease (PD) patients. Thirty-five STN patients and 16 GPi patients were assessed at 5 to 6 years after DBS surgery. Primary outcome measure was the stimulation effect on the motor Unified Parkinson's Disease Rating Scale (UPDRS) assessed with a prospective cross-over double-blind assessment without medications (stimulation was randomly switched on or off). Secondary outcomes were motor UPDRS changes with unblinded assessments in off- and on-medication states with and without stimulation, activities of daily living (ADL), anti-PD medications, and dyskinesias. In double-blind assessment, both STN and GPi DBS were significantly effective in improving the motor UPDRS scores (STN, P < 0.0001, 45.4%; GPi, P = 0.008, 20.0%) compared with off-stimulation, regardless of the sequence of stimulation. In open assessment, both STN- and GPi-DBS significantly improved the off-medication motor UPDRS when compared with before surgery (STN, P < 0.001, 50.5%; GPi, P = 0.002, 35.6%). Dyskinesias and ADL were significantly improved in both groups. Anti-PD medications were significantly reduced only in the STN group. Adverse events were more frequent in the STN group. These results confirm the long-term efficacy of STN and GPi DBS in advanced PD. Although the surgical targets were not randomized, there was a trend to a better outcome of motor signs in the STN-DBS patients and fewer adverse events in the GPi-DBS group.

The revised (new) consensus clinical diagnostic criteria for multiple system atrophy (MSA) were published in 2008. To validate these criteria, we utilized the same cohort that we reported previously, which included 59 patients with a clinical diagnosis of MSA that was confirmed neuropathologically in 51 of them at the Queen Square Brain Bank for Neurological Disorders. At the first clinic visit, sensitivity with new consensus possible category was higher, and PPV marginally higher, than for clinical diagnosis and old consensus possible category. New consensus probable category showed marginally higher sensitivity than, and the same PPV as, old consensus probable category. At the last clinic visit, new consensus possible category had exactly the same sensitivity and only marginally higher PPV compared with old consensus possible category. New consensus probable category showed the same sensitivity and PPV as old consensus probable category. Our data indicate that in this case material the new consensus criteria for possible MSA could improve diagnostic accuracy at first neurological evaluation compared with the old consensus criteria. Prospective clinicopathological validation studies of the new consensus criteria, particularly incorporating in vivo structural and functional imaging results, are required to extend the current findings.

Little is known about the rate of progression of striatal dysfunction in subjects with parkin-linked parkinsonism. Being a heterozygous parkin gene carrier may confer susceptibility to Parkinson's disease (PD). In a previous (18)F-dopa PET study, we reported that 69% of carriers of a single parkin mutation showed subclinical loss of putamen dopaminergic function. Using serial (18)F-dopa PET, the present longitudinal study addresses rates of progression of nigrostriatal dysfunction in both compound heterozygous (parkin-linked parkinsonism) and single heterozygous parkin gene carriers. Three symptomatic patients who were compound heterozygotes for parkin gene mutations and six asymptomatic heterozygous carriers were clinically assessed and had (18)F-dopa PET at baseline and again after 5 years. The patients with symptomatic parkin showed a mean 0.5% annual reduction in putamen (18)F-dopa uptake over 5 years while caudate (18)F-dopa uptake declined by a mean annual rate of 2 %. The asymptomatic heterozygote gene carriers showed a mean 0.56% annual reduction in putamen and 0.62 % annual reduction in caudate (18)F-dopa uptake. Neurological examination at both baseline and follow-up showed no evidence of parkinsonism. Loss of nigrostriatal dysfunction in parkin-linked parkinsonism occurs at a very slow rate compared to the 9-12% annual loss of putamen (18)F-dopa uptake reported for idiopathic PD. Although subclinical reductions of striatal (18)F-dopa uptake are common in carriers of a single parkin mutation their slow rate of progression suggests that few if any of these will develop clinical parkinsonism.

Paroxysmal exercise-induced dyskinesias (PED) are involuntary intermittent movements triggered by prolonged physical exertion. Autosomal dominant inheritance may occur. Recently, mutations in the glucose transporter 1 (GLUT1) gene (chr. 1p35-p31.3) have been identified as a cause in some patients with autosomal dominant PED. Mutations in this gene have previously been associated with the GLUT1 deficiency syndrome. We performed mutational analysis in 10 patients with apparently sporadic PED. We identified two novel GLUT1 mutations, at least one likely to be de-novo, in two of our patients. Onset was in early childhood. One of our patients had a predating history of childhood absence epilepsy and a current history of hemiplegic migraine as well as a family history of migraine. The other patient had no other symptoms apart from PED. Brain MRI showed cerebellar atrophy in one case. Mutations in GLUT1 are one cause of apparently sporadic PED. The detection of this has important implications for treatment as ketogenic diet has been reported to be beneficial.

A body of literature now exists, which demonstrates that idiopathic Parkinson's disease (PD) has a major negative impact on quality of life (QoL), and that depression and cognitive impairment are among the main predictors of poor QoL in this disorder. Relatively little work has been done to assess the differential contribution of the specific symptoms of PD to QoL, which was the aim of this study. One hundred thirty patients with PD completed a booklet of questionnaires, which included the PDQ39 as a disease-specific measure of QoL, a symptom checklist, a mobility checklist, as well as patient ratings of disease stage and disability. The results indicated that the contribution of physical, medication-related, and cognitive/psychiatric symptoms to QoL can be significant. Sudden unpredictable on/off states, difficulty in dressing, difficulty in walking, falls, depression, and confusion were PD symptoms, which significantly influenced QoL scores. Among the mobility problems associated with PD, start hesitation, shuffling gait, freezing, festination, propulsion, and difficulty in turning had a significant effect on QoL scores. In addition to depression and anxiety, the major predictors of QoL were shuffling, difficulty turning, falls, difficulty in dressing, fatigue, confusion, autonomic disturbance particularly urinary incontinence, unpredictable on/off fluctuations, and sensory symptoms such as pain. The implications of these results for the medical management of PD are discussed.
